Welcome to Cuba Café Restaurant

Cuba Café Restaurant offers a vibrant taste of authentic Cuban cuisine, reminiscent of Little Havana in Miami. Nestled in Las Vegas, this charming tapas bar captivates diners with its warm atmosphere, rich flavors, and a menu highlighting Cuban staples like the classic Cuban sandwich and lechon asado. Customers cherish the slow-paced dining experience paired with live music on weekends, enhancing the lively charm of the restaurant. The thoughtful service, colorful cocktails, and the option for vegan dishes cater to diverse tastes. The Cuba Café Restaurant is a culinary escape that invites guests to savor each flavorful bite.

Welcome to Cuba Café Restaurant, a delightful gem nestled at 2055 E Tropicana Ave #1, Las Vegas, NV. This charming establishment captures the true essence of Cuban culture, offering an authentic culinary experience that transports diners straight to the vibrant streets of Little Havana.

If you're on the hunt for a cozy tapas bar that fuses relaxation with exquisite flavors, look no further. Cuba Café is an inviting space adorned with colorful decor, setting the scene for a memorable dining experience. The atmosphere is casual yet energetic, making it perfect for families, groups, or a low-key date night.

  • Diverse Menu: The menu offers a tantalizing array of Cuban dishes, with standout options like the classic Cuban Sandwich and Lechon Asado. The ingredients are fresh and flavorful, showcasing the rich traditions of Cuban cuisine. As one customer noted, the food is harmoniously simple yet undeniably delicious.
  • Happy Hour Specials: Enjoy fantastic drink deals during happy hours, featuring strong tropical cocktails that are perfect for unwinding after a long day. Many patrons rave about their mojitos and pina coladas, which are known for their generous pours.
  • Live Music & Dancing: For those looking for a lively evening out, plan your visit on weekends when the restaurant transforms into a vibrant venue complete with live music and a dance floor. Experience the rhythm of Cuba as you dine and dance the night away!
  • Family-Friendly: With options for kids and a welcoming attitude towards family dining, Cuba Café caters to all ages. Their waiter service adds to the relaxed atmosphere, allowing you to savor every bite without the rush.
  • Accessible Options: Whether you want to dine in, takeout, or have your meal delivered, Cuba Café has you covered. They also provide vegan options, making it a versatile choice for various dietary preferences.
